Quantitative Solutions in Hydrogeology and Groundwater Modeling addresses and solves a variety of questions and problems from hydrogeological practice. It includes major aspects of quantitative groundwater evaluation, from basic laboratory determination of hydrogeological parameters to complex analytical calculations and modeling for engineering purposes.
Groundwater modeling is a strong trend in hydrogeology. Recent years have seen the rapid development of sophisticated and powerful groundwater models, along with a decrease in the use of the more mathematically demanding analytical quantitative solutions. Quantitative Solutions in Hydrogeology and Groundwater Modeling avoids this conflict by explaining both modeling and mathematical solutions in detail.
Addresses and solves questions and problems from hydrogeological practice, combining theory and practice in hydrogeology and groundwater modeling. Discusses major aspects of quantitative groundwater evaluation, from basic laboratory determination of hydrogeological parameters to complex analytical calculations and modeling, and offers analytic solutions of one- and two-dimension groundwater flow problems. Other subjects include aquifer testing, characterization of groundwater flow domain for modeling, and a detailed explanation of the groundwater modeling program USGS MODFLOW.
